  • Increased application performance by between 10% and 20%.

Testimonials

“Our HNAS platform provides a way to grow our NAS solution with our user base, without having to select a new platform every time business growth rates change. The clustered hardware ensures that we have peace of mind from a redundancy point of view, should failures occur.”
